Is Dove Kids Shampoo Safe?

Published in Kids Shampoo Safety 2 mins read

Yes, Dove Kids shampoo is considered safe for children.

Dove takes the safety and quality of their kids' products very seriously. According to the provided reference, the entire Dove Kids skincare range, which includes their shampoos, has been rigorously tested by experts. Specifically:

  • Dermatologist-tested: This means skin specialists have evaluated the products and deemed them safe for use on children's skin.
  • Ophthalmologist-tested: This indicates that eye specialists have tested the products and confirmed that they are safe for contact with children's eyes.

This testing is significant, as it demonstrates that Dove's kids’ products, including their shampoos, are formulated to be gentle and suitable for young, sensitive skin and hair. The company states that every body wash (and by extension, their shampoo products as part of the same skincare range) is "approved by experts, and is safe for kids' skin, hair and eyes".

Why is this important?

Children often have more delicate skin and eyes compared to adults. Therefore, products designed for them must be carefully formulated to minimize any potential irritation. The fact that Dove Kids shampoo undergoes both dermatologist and ophthalmologist testing underscores its commitment to safety and gentleness.
